Hi Jane,

If you are covered by health insurance, I believe this too could be switched to generic Prozac by the pharmacists, unless a DAW is written by your doctor in the script. Of course, the issue of generic Prozac becomes moot if you are paying for your own prescription and prefers to continue with the more expensive brand name, Prozac.
